2 people arrested after dispute at Carlisle Limousin sale


May 11, 2021 12:33 pm
A man and a woman were arrested after a dispute broke out at a Limousin cattle sale at Borderway Mart in Carlisle in the UK.
Police in Cumbria were called out to the dispute which occurred at around 8:50 last Thursday evening (May 6).
A Cumbria Police spokesperson said: “A 61-year-old male, from Sheffield, sustained a slight injury to his head.
“A 53-year-old male from Shropshire was arrested for assault and later cautioned for the offence.
“Also, a 57-year-old female from Shropshire was arrested for public order offence and also cautioned.”

Cumbria police warn of prescription drugs linked with deaths


Cumbria police warn of prescription drugs linked with deaths
Drugs
Police in Cumbria are warning of the dangers of buying prescription drugs online – with many deaths linked to the issue.
Cumbria police are teaming up with professionals who help people steer clear of substance misuse to warn of the dangers.
Constabulary officers and staff from Unity, the alcohol and drug recovery service, are issuing the advice following a number of deaths suspected to be linked to this issue in recent years.
Prescription drugs falling into the bracket of benzodiazepines, which are known as benzos and include diazepam (sometimes referred to as Valium), are suspected to have been a factor in some of the deaths.  ....

Cumbrian teen hospitalised after adverse reaction to cannabis 'sweets'


06/04/2021
A Cumbrian teenager is reported to have been hospitalised after suffering an adverse reaction to sweets containing cannabis oil.
Police in Cumbria have been alerted to a number of incidents across the county involving young people taking sweets believed to include CBD oil, a chemical substance found in cannabis.
Officers have been made aware of a teenager from Cumbria who has been hospitalised having suffered adverse reactions after consuming the gummies.
North Cumbria Integrated Care NHS Foundation Trust (NCIC) has joined Cumbria police in raising awareness and sharing the warnings for young people.

Cumbria police issue 39 fixed penalty notices for COVID-19 breaches


Cumbria police issue 39 fixed penalty notices for COVID-19 breaches
Police in Cumbria issued 39 fixed penalty notices for coronavirus offences during the Easter weekend.
During the four-day bank holiday weekend, officers worked with partner agencies across the county to tackle a range of issues including meeting indoors and large groups meeting outdoors.
Superintendent Carl Patrick said: “Over the four-day bank holiday weekend our officers worked with partner agencies across the county to help keep people safe.
